Figure 4

Probability analysis for disease deterioration following an early second NP SARS-CoV-2 PCR test in SARS-CoV-2 infected individuals with a “positive window”. (a) Probability of infected adults ≥ 18 years with a “positive window” tested a second time within the first week following diagnosis to deteriorate to severe COVID-19. Blue circles represent individuals who tested negative, orange circles represent individuals who tested positive and green circles represent individuals who were not tested in the week following diagnosis. Grey lines indicate 95% confidence intervals. (b) Log odds ratio (OR) for severe COVID-19 was calculated by the result of the early second PCR test in patients with a “positive window” and without. OR > 0 indicated larger risk in the population that tested positive compared to the population tested negative. Calculated log odds ratios are presented along with gray lines indicating 95% confidence intervals. (c) Same probability analysis for individuals ≥ 60 years old. (d) Log odds ratio (OR) for severe COVID-19 for individuals ≥ 60 years old.
